1. Produktua amaitu daview

The eSUN eBOX Lite is an upgraded filament dryer box designed to maintain optimal conditions for 3D printing filaments. It effectively removes moisture, preventing common printing issues such as stringing, clogging, and poor adhesion. This device also functions as a filament storage box and spool holder, providing a comprehensive solution for filament management.

Key features include efficient heating, even temperature distribution, low-noise operation, and broad compatibility with various filament types and spool sizes.

3. Konfiguratzeko argibideak

  1. Lekua: Place the eBOX Lite on a stable, flat surface away from direct sunlight, heat sources, and excessive humidity. Ensure adequate ventilation around the unit.
  2. Potentzia-konexioa: Connect the provided power adapter to the DC input port on the back of the eBOX Lite. Plug the adapter into a standard US power outlet (AC100-240V ~ 50/60Hz).
  3. Harizpia kargatzen:
    • Open the transparent lid of the eBOX Lite.
    • Place your filament spool onto the internal rollers. Ensure the spool rotates freely. The maximum compatible spool size is Φ200mm (diameter) x 73mm (height).
    • Thread the filament through the designated outlet hole on the lid. If using the outlet conduit, attach it to the hole and thread the filament through it.
    • Itxi estalkia ongi.

4. Funtzionamendu-argibideak

The eBOX Lite features a simple control panel with a display and buttons for setting temperature and time.

4.1. Kontrol panela baino gehiagoview

  • Pantaila: Shows current settings (temperature level, time remaining).
  • Modu botoia: Used to cycle between temperature setting mode and time setting mode.
  • Gora / Behera botoiak: Used to adjust values (temperature level, time).

4.2. Tenperatura eta ordua ezartzea

  1. Piztu: After connecting the power, the display will light up.
  2. Set Temperature Level:
    • Sakatu Modua button once to enter temperature setting mode. The display will show a number (1, 2, or 3).
    • Erabili Gora/Behera buttons to select the desired temperature level based on your filament type:
      • 1. maila: Approximately 40°C (suitable for PLA/PLA+)
      • 2. maila: Approximately 50°C (suitable for ABS/ABS+/PETG)
      • 3. maila: Approximately 55°C (suitable for PVA/Nylon/PC)
    • Sakatu Modua button again to confirm the temperature level and proceed to time setting.
  3. Set Heating Time:
    • The display will now show the time setting (e.g., "00.0h").
    • Erabili Gora/Behera buttons to set the desired heating duration from 0 to 18 hours. For optimal drying, eSUN recommends at least 2 hours for most filaments.
    • Sakatu Modua button again to start the drying process. The display will show the remaining time.

The eBOX Lite will maintain the set temperature and humidity throughout the drying cycle. Once the time expires, the heating will stop, but the box will continue to provide a dry storage environment.

5. Mantentzea

Regular maintenance ensures the longevity and optimal performance of your eBOX Lite.

  • Garbiketa: Wipe the exterior of the unit with a soft, dry cloth. Do not use abrasive cleaners or solvents. Ensure the unit is unplugged before cleaning.
  • Barne garbiketa: Periodically check the inside of the box for any dust or filament debris. Use a soft brush or compressed air to remove any accumulation.
  • Biltegiratzea: Denbora luzez erabiltzen ez duzunean, deskonektatu gailua eta gorde leku fresko eta lehor batean.

6. Arazoak

ArazoaKausa posibleaIrtenbidea
Gailua ez da pizten.Korronte-egokitzailea ez dago konektatuta edo akastuna; korronte-hartunearen arazoa.Ensure power adapter is securely connected. Try a different power outlet. Check if the power adapter is damaged.
Harizpia ez da ondo lehortzen.Incorrect temperature level set; insufficient drying time; lid not closed properly.Verify the correct temperature level for your filament type. Increase drying time (e.g., to 4-6 hours or more for very wet filament). Ensure the lid is fully closed.
Pantaila hutsik dago edo ez du erantzuten.Temporary software glitch; power interruption.Unplug the device, wait 30 seconds, then plug it back in. If the issue persists, contact customer support.
Filament spool does not rotate smoothly.Spool too large or not seated correctly; debris on rollers.Ensure spool dimensions are within specifications (Φ200mm x 73mm). Re-seat the spool. Clean the rollers.
